CVE-2010-1812: Use-after-free vulnerability in WebKit in Apple iOS before 4.1 on the iPhone and iPod touch, and webkitgtk...

Use-after-free vulnerability in WebKit in Apple iOS before 4.1 on the iPhone and iPod touch, and webkitgtk before 1.2.6, all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code or cause a denial of service (application crash) via vectors involving selections.

CVE-2010-1812 is an old WebKit memory-safety flaw. Malicious web content involving text selections could crash the application or potentially run code on vulnerable iPhone, iPod touch, or WebKitGTK systems. Business urgency is mainly for legacy or embedded systems still running the affected software. Exposure is most likely in unmanaged legacy Apple mobile devices, old Linux desktop/server packages, kiosk systems, or embedded applications using WebKitGTK below 1.2.6. Modern supported platforms are unlikely to be affected, but the source bundle does not provide a complete product matrix. Treat as high priority only where legacy WebKit remains in use. The issue can support remote code execution, but it is from 2010 and the provided evidence does not show active exploitation. Focus on finding and retiring outdated WebKit dependencies. Mitigation focus: Upgrade iPhone and iPod touch devices to iOS 4.1 or later where applicable.; Update WebKitGTK packages to 1.2.6 or vendor-patched versions.; Retire or isolate unsupported devices that cannot receive vendor security updates..
